Beirut: Lebanese newspapers have highlighted key political developments in their headlines for February 5, 2025. An-Nahar reported that Barrot's visit to Beirut includes discussions on the Paris Conference and the neutralization of Lebanon. Additionally, the "Between-the-Rivers" plan is expected to be activated once the army commander returns.
According to National News Agency - Lebanon, Al-Akhbar highlighted Hezbollah's presence at Baabda, with plans for Salam to head south on Saturday. There is also a renewed internal focus on strategies concerning Iran. Al-Joumhouria reported on Aoun's preparation of legal complaints against Israel, accusing it of environmental harm. Meanwhile, Raad emphasized the importance of understanding and cooperation during his visit to Baabda.
Nidaa Al-Watan noted that Hezbollah is adopting a softer tone towards Baabda, with attention on the potential outcomes of Haykal's visit to the U.S. These headlines underscore the ongoing political dynamics and international engagements impacting Lebanon.
